Broken Glass

While composite doors are durable, they're susceptible to being damaged by impacts. Children playing, a stray object knocking on the door or even burglars are all possible causes. A broken panel can pose an immediate safety risk and should be replaced as quickly as is feasible.

Replacing the glass on a composite door is relatively simple however you must be careful to ensure that the new glass is properly inserted into the frame. Be sure to remove all the steel clips that keep the glass in place. This can be done using an screwdriver with a flat head. Once all the metal has been removed, you can install the new glass in the opening. Use painter's tap or have a person hold the new glass while you seal the edges.

Also, make sure whether the weather seal is intact and is not cracked or worn. It is important to check the seal because a cracked one could cause air leaks or allow moisture to enter your home. It is important to note that you can often buy replacement weather seals for composite doors at hardware stores. To achieve the best results, you should choose a weatherseal that is specifically designed to fit composite door crack repair doors.

Many homeowners have issues with their composite doors becoming difficult to open and close due to contraction and expansion. The materials used in composite doors expand and shrink when temperatures fluctuate. This could cause them to lose their shape and cause the door to crack or warp. This is not a major issue, but it is important to be aware of it.

If you're having this issue, you can try to lubricate the hinges. This will reduce the friction on the hinges and will also increase the mobility of your door. It is possible to use a specific lubricant for composite door glass replacement doors since other options could damage the material. After applying the lubricant, test the door to determine whether it is moving smoothly or not.

Damaged Hinges

Composite doors are known for their strength and security, making them a great choice for your home. However, as with all fittings and fixtures in the home they are susceptible to issues from time to time. It's a good idea to know that most of these issues are minor and can be easily fixed with a minimum of effort. Maintaining your composite door frame repair door will ensure that it functions at its best for many years.

While certain issues can be dealt with by the average homeowner It's best to consult with an expert of the best way to proceed. This will reduce the risk of damage and ensure that all necessary adjustments are made in a timely manner.

If you're experiencing stiffness opening your door or gaps in the frame, these problems are usually solved by adjusting the hinges. Most modern composite doors feature self-lubricating bearings, so a little adjustment should be enough to solve the issue. In certain situations, it could be necessary to replace all the hinges if they are damaged.

Stripped screw holes are another reason that can cause loose hinges. This happens when the wood fibers around the screws have become worn down, preventing them from gripping properly. In this situation it is recommended to use longer screws to secure hinges.

Weather seals can also loosen over time as a result of exposure to sunlight or changes in humidity. This can allow rainwater or draughts into your home. It is important to check the seals regularly to ensure they are in position and working properly.

If your doors are stiff when closed, or the latch isn't working with the keeper, these issues are usually resolved by changing the hinges and locking mechanism. You should also lubricate the lock to prevent further damage. After all adjustments have been made, it's important to test the door's function to make sure that it closes and opens smoothly, without resistance or sound. These simple tasks will assist in stopping your composite door from becoming misaligned or sagging. They can also help keep your home secure and comfortable.

Sagging Frames

In the summer, composite doors are more prone to swelling or warping because of sunlight. This could make the door more difficult to open or close, particularly for homeowners who live in homes with a south-facing view. Fortunately, this problem is fairly common and is easily fixed.

This problem is usually caused by hinges or screws that have been loosened from the frame. This can be corrected by re tightening the hinges or replacing them with screws that are longer. It's also a good idea to lubricate the hinges regularly to ensure they don't get misaligned over time.

It may be required to raise the bottom hinge a little, based on how long you have been using your Composite door repairs near me door. A loose hinge can cause the door to sag and therefore it's best to check them on a regular basis to make sure they're still solid. Add some shims to bring the hinge closer towards the frame. This will make it easier to open and close the door.

The weather seals and gaskets in your composite door can also lose their elasticity, which can lead to gaps and leaks. This is usually easy to fix, and it's done by using an abrasive or damp sponge. It is recommended to clean your door's entire surface each week to keep it in good condition and remove any dirt that could cause further problems.

The same issues can be encountered when you lock your composite door paint repair door as they can be with other components. Dirt can cause the cylinder for your key to become stiff or even difficult to turn. Utilizing an lubricant made of silicon on the cylinder will help solve this problem. It is a good idea to regularly lubricate lock mechanisms every six months with the same product to ensure they work properly.

The majority of the time, sagging doors are caused by hinges that are loose. These can be fixed by tightening them or replacing them with hinges that are longer. The door can also expand in the summer and cause an opening to appear between the frame and the door. To prevent this from happening, keep the door away from direct sunlight. Use curtains or awnings to shade the door when you can. It's also recommended to use air conditioners or fans to cool down the house and lower humidity levels.

Your composite door may have issues from time to time, just as other doors in your home. One common problem is a lock that is not functioning properly. This can be caused by debris build-up or a faulty mechanism. If you are having difficulties locking, closing or opening your door, an experienced professional should repair the lock.

Multipoint locks are fitted to most uPVC doors as well as composite doors. These locks have several bolts ranging from 3-5 points. This makes it difficult for burglars to break through the door. The key is inserted into a euro-cylinder in order to operate multipoint locks. When you pull the handle lever, several hooks connect to the bolts, allowing the door to be locked or unlocked using the key.

There are also doors with composite locks that come with split spindle operation. You can open and shut the door by lifting the lever handle, but only if you are inside the house. Then, you can utilize the key to open the latch bolt and get back inside if you're outside.
